What is a Compact Rollator?
A compact rollator is a kind of wheeled walker developed to support people with mobility obstacles. These rollators feature a lightweight frame, typically made from aluminum or similar products, and are geared up with 3 or 4 wheels, handgrips, and a seat for resting. They are developed to be quickly maneuverable and foldable for simple transportation and storage, making them ideal for both indoor and outdoor use.

When selecting a compact rollator, certain aspects need to be thought about to ensure it fulfills the user's requirements. Here is a list of vital criteria to assess:

How do I keep my compact rollator?
Routine maintenance includes inspecting the brakes, cleaning up the wheels, and checking the frame for any indications of wear.
2. Can I use a compact rollator for outdoor activities?
Yes, lots of compact rollators are developed to handle numerous surfaces. Always examine the wheel size and material to ensure they are suitable for outdoor use.

4. Are compact rollators adjustable for tall people?
The majority of compact rollators feature adjustable manage heights, accommodating a variety of user heights, including taller individuals.
5. Can a compact rollator fit in my automobile trunk?
The majority of compact rollators are created to fold quickly, enabling them to suit a lot of automobile trunks. Make sure to measure your trunk space initially for confirmation.
